// REINDEX_BATCH_CAP limits docs per shard pass in the Tallowfield
// nightly search reindex. Raising it starves the ingest queue;
// lowering it overruns the maintenance window. 5000 is the tested
// sweet spot. Change only with a soak run. Verified against the
// build noted below.

session token of bawif-hahog = htk6_ac5981

## Configuration

The Crashfall pipeline ingests crash reports from the Pebblenote mobile app and batches them into the triage queue. Most knobs live in .env: BATCH_SIZE (keep it under 500 unless ingest is backed up), RETENTION_DAYS, and SYMBOLICATE=true. Future maintainers: don't touch the queue name, everything downstream assumes it. Add the ingest API secret on the very next line.

sealed setting: RELAY_SECRET5=82864

## Data Stores: Orders Soft Deletes

The Marrowbit `orders` table uses soft deletes: `deleted_at` timestamp, never hard-deleted. All reads must filter `deleted_at IS NULL`; the ORM scope handles this, raw SQL does not. Weekly purge job archives rows older than 18 months to `orders_cold`. Known issue: reporting queries occasionally miss the filter — flag these in review. To inspect live data, use the read replica via the string below.

primary connection of yagep-kahip = redis://giliel_svc:zYiKsLL2PLpfPL@db-348f.xolmarsys.corp:5432/fenwyn

Hey Priya — handover note as you take over from me on the Skylark Mini retirement. Short version: last manufacturing run finished at the Dunmore plant, support winds down over twelve months, and trade-in offers go out to existing customers next quarter. Biggest open item is the spares inventory decision — don't let it drift. One confidential note on the replacement plans is just below.

board note of fahif-yahog: Gross margin on Wenath came in at 10 percent against a plan of 5 percent. Only 3 of the 100 pilot accounts renewed Wenath, so a churn review is set for July 15.